MENTAL STRENGTH

MENTAL STRENGTH

Scripture Reading: 1 Corinthians 2:6-16
Devotional:- “For "who has known the mind of the LORD that he may instruct Him?" But we have the mind of Christ” (v. 16) NKJV

    Our mind is the processor for our strength. Our mind is the place where the strength of life is directed before it manifests physically. That is why it is the state of the mind of a man that determines the strength of his life. No matter how strong spiritually a man could be, if the mind is not cooperating, the man will still be weak. It is the mind that is the battle ground of life. That is why you must avoid sin to avoid condemnation. The act of condemnation will always break down the strength of the mind. If anyone is walking after the flesh or worldly way the devil will always push such to condemnation (Romans 8:1). 

By your mind I am referring to your soul. Your soul is having three compartments: the intellect, the will and the emotion. The intellect think, the will decide and the emotion drives your actions. For a soul to be strong, you must mind what you are thinking, this will determine your decision and action (Proverbs 4:23). A strong mind will do everything to retain positive and possible thought always. This is not always easy except by the help of the Hoy Spirit.

To keep a strong mind, then labor to store the word of God in your mind (Colossians 3:16). The word of God is always positive. When it constitutes your thinking, it will strengthen your mind for right action and for right result. The word of God will give you value in life. That is why it will produce in you good success (Joshua 1:8). Peace.

 PRAYER: Lord, give me the grace to build a strong mind.
